Output 25e876267ae8684116b6851e3cb6b3a5873c57b7ba357e233720f7ea959b3f63:18

value
251634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0494e3f9b98352f55f112418ebdc9610dd027c4 OP_EQUAL
address
3LgLHoz7QNrw7ty9bJUaENdaENDS4kwVdf
transaction
25e876267ae8684116b6851e3cb6b3a5873c57b7ba357e233720f7ea959b3f63
spent
true